Output 5f8874c8a25bf48add5fde62a56f198366e671cbedc9681367e25e5147bed16d: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ca172caad3d1691d8534af7d22266eedc439cc8d OP_EQUAL
address
3L7aBV4pQP94ABzBUUvPTn4YDqCBDCZBXz
transaction
5f8874c8a25bf48add5fde62a56f198366e671cbedc9681367e25e5147bed16d
confirmations
255312
spent
true